Winter is associated not only with New Year, sledging and snow. It also brings icy conditions, frostbite, and serious injuries.

When the pavement turns into an ice rink, the main rule is to choose comfortable footwear. You should move cautiously, stepping on your entire sole. It is important to remember that during icy conditions, it is hundreds of times harder for a car to stop than for a person.

When walking past multi-storey buildings, do not walk close to the walls. It is necessary to avoid all possible accumulations of snow and ice hanging from roofs and trees.

Under no circumstances should you jump into snowdrifts. Beneath the layer of snow, there may be stones, various household waste, pits, industrial tanks, and more. For instance, in February 2021, in Lepel, a child fell into a water collection tank located in a wasteland behind the reception and procurement point while playing in the winter. The aforementioned tank was covered with snow and resembled a slide, thus not being perceived as a danger by the minor. Following this incident, the tank was covered with sand, but due to weather conditions, the sand subsided, and the well again posed a danger to minors. In June 2021, by order of the district prosecutor's office, the aforementioned tank was dismantled.

It is best to avoid water bodies in winter. Going out onto the ice alone is unsafe. A few minutes of joy are not worth a human life. If going out onto the ice is unavoidable, you must remember that jumping and stamping on the ice is forbidden. It is unacceptable to play on frozen water bodies; ice skating should only be done on specially equipped rinks.

Adhering to these simple rules will help preserve your health and avoid injuries and accidents during the winter period.
